const DEFAULT_ANTHROPIC_VERSION: &str = "2023-06-01";

/// Caller-supplied `extra` keys we forward to Anthropic's Messages API.
///
/// This is an allowlist on purpose: `ChatCompletionParams.extra` is an
/// unbounded catch-all that also holds internal E2EE keys and OpenAI-only
/// fields, so we only pass through the reasoning controls Anthropic actually
/// understands (`thinking`) plus `reasoning_effort` (which Anthropic does not
/// accept and will reject with its own 400, instead of us silently dropping it).
const ANTHROPIC_PASSTHROUGH_KEYS: &[&str] = &["thinking", "reasoning_effort"];

/// Pick the allowlisted reasoning-control fields out of `extra`.
fn extract_passthrough(
extra: &std::collections::HashMap<String, serde_json::Value>,
) -> std::collections::HashMap<String, serde_json::Value> {
ANTHROPIC_PASSTHROUGH_KEYS
.iter()
.filter_map(|&key| extra.get(key).map(|value| (key.to_string(), value.clone())))
.collect()
}

#[test]
fn test_build_request_forwards_thinking_config() {
let backend = AnthropicBackend::new();
let mut params = make_params(None, None);
let thinking = serde_json::json!({"type": "enabled", "budget_tokens": 4096});
params
.extra
.insert("thinking".to_string(), thinking.clone());

let request = backend.build_request("claude-opus-4-7", &params, false);
let body = serde_json::to_value(&request).unwrap();

// The native Anthropic `thinking` object is forwarded verbatim as a
// top-level request field so Anthropic applies extended thinking.
assert_eq!(body.get("thinking"), Some(&thinking));
}

#[test]
fn test_build_request_forwards_reasoning_effort() {
let backend = AnthropicBackend::new();
let mut params = make_params(None, None);
params.extra.insert(
"reasoning_effort".to_string(),
serde_json::Value::String("high".to_string()),
);

let request = backend.build_request("claude-opus-4-7", &params, false);
let body = serde_json::to_value(&request).unwrap();

// We forward `reasoning_effort` rather than silently dropping it.
// Anthropic validates the field and returns its own error if unsupported.
assert_eq!(
body.get("reasoning_effort"),
Some(&serde_json::Value::String("high".to_string()))
);
}

#[test]
fn test_build_request_does_not_leak_openai_only_params() {
let backend = AnthropicBackend::new();
let mut params = make_params(None, None);
// Typed OpenAI-only sampling params live in named struct fields, never
// in `extra`, so they must not appear in the Anthropic request body.
params.frequency_penalty = Some(0.5);
params.presence_penalty = Some(0.5);

let request = backend.build_request("claude-opus-4-7", &params, false);
let body = serde_json::to_value(&request).unwrap();

assert!(body.get("frequency_penalty").is_none());
assert!(body.get("presence_penalty").is_none());
}

#[test]
fn test_build_request_drops_non_allowlisted_extra_keys() {
let backend = AnthropicBackend::new();
let mut params = make_params(Some(1.0), None);
params.stop = Some(vec!["STOP".to_string()]);
// `extra` is an unbounded catch-all. None of these may reach Anthropic:
// internal E2EE keys, OpenAI-only fields, or keys that collide with the
// named request fields (`system`, `stop_sequences`).
for key in [
"x_signing_algo",
"x_client_pub_key",
"x_encryption_version",
"x_encrypt_all_fields",
"max_completion_tokens",
"frequency_penalty",
"presence_penalty",
"response_format",
"system",
"stop_sequences",
] {
params
.extra
.insert(key.to_string(), serde_json::json!("leak"));
}

let request = backend.build_request("claude-opus-4-7", &params, false);
let obj = serde_json::to_value(&request).unwrap();
let obj = obj.as_object().unwrap();

// No internal/OpenAI-only key leaked through.
for key in [
"x_signing_algo",
"x_client_pub_key",
"x_encryption_version",
"x_encrypt_all_fields",
"max_completion_tokens",
"frequency_penalty",
"presence_penalty",
"response_format",
] {
assert!(obj.get(key).is_none(), "{key} must not be forwarded");
}
// Named fields keep their derived values, not the `extra` collision.
assert!(obj.get("system").is_none()); // no system message -> field absent
assert_eq!(
obj.get("stop_sequences"),
Some(&serde_json::json!(["STOP"])),
"stop_sequences must come from params.stop, not extra"
);
}

#[test]
fn test_build_request_empty_extra_adds_no_fields() {
let backend = AnthropicBackend::new();
let params = make_params(Some(1.0), None);
let request = backend.build_request("claude-opus-4-7", &params, false);
let body = serde_json::to_value(&request).unwrap();

// With no extra fields, the flattened `extra` map contributes nothing:
// the serialized request carries only the known Anthropic fields.
let keys: std::collections::HashSet<&str> = body
.as_object()
.unwrap()
.keys()
.map(|k| k.as_str())
.collect();
let expected: std::collections::HashSet<&str> =
["model", "messages", "max_tokens", "temperature", "stream"]
.into_iter()
.collect();
assert_eq!(keys, expected);
}
